A bit about my approach to therapy

My approach includes helping to guide my clients on their healing journey by using a Cognitive Behavioral Framework that is person-centered and strengths based. I work collaboratively with clients to address how thoughts, feelings and behaviors interconnect, also to identify their unique strengths and leverage them in order to overcome challenges, achieve goals and create meaningful change in their lives.
